comparemela.com
Home
Ladpura Ajmer
Top Locations Tagged with Ladpura Ajmer
Ladpura Ajmer in India - 305023/Information-technology-company near Ajmer
1). Raj Computer Mobile Ladpura Ajmer City India
2). Bal Public School Ladpura Ajmer India
3). G B Computers Ladpura Ajmer India
vimarsana © 2020. All Rights Reserved.